Bike Sales Report For December 2020: Honda Two-Wheelers Registers 3% Yearly Growth
Honda Motorcycle & Scooter India (HMSI) has announced the sales report for December 2020. As per the sales report, the company has registered a total of 2,63,027 scooters and motorcycle sold in the previous month.
This a 3 per cent increase in overall sales as compared to the 2,55,283 units sold during the same month last year. Out of the 2,63,027 units sold by the brand in the last month, 2,42,046 units were from domestic sales. While the rest 20,981 units came from exports of two-wheelers by the brand to various international markets.
Honda's domestic sales grew 5% to 242,046 units in the year 2020's last month compared to 230,197 units a year ago. According to the company, it has registered positive growth for the 5th consecutive month after the pandemic.
The first quarter of the current financial year was rough due to the Covid-19 pandemic. While the second quarter helped in stabilizing the ecosystem and meeting the pent-up demand. The third quarter of FY'2020-21, however, has been a good three months for HMSI.
During the third quarter of the current financial year between October and December 2020, the company has registered its first positive quarter in Year-on-Year sales comparison. Honda's Q3 domestic sales jumped 5% on YoY basis to 11,49,101 units in Q3, FY'21 from 10,91,299 units in the same period last year.
Mr Yadvinder Singh Guleria, Director - Sales & Marketing, Honda Motorcycle & Scooter India Pvt. Ltd. said, "After the positive retail and wholesale traction in December'20, we enter 2021 with a new hope. The 3rd quarter marked the first quarter of positive sales after a long time. The next 2 quarters too, are expected to show some growth due to the low base effect but real positive growth and market expansion may take some time.
However, we are all geared up for 2021 - Honda's momentous 20th Anniversary year in India. With multiple brand new and exciting offerings in the pipeline, Honda will delight riders across categories with new Joy of Riding."
